What Is Adaptive Reuse?
Adaptive reuse is the process of repurposing an old building for a new function. For example, an abandoned factory might become loft apartments, or an old post office could be transformed into a boutique hotel.
The approach prioritizes preserving the building’s structure and character while updating it to meet modern safety, accessibility, and energy standards.
Why Adaptive Reuse Is Gaining Popularity
- Sustainability – Reusing existing structures reduces construction waste, conserves materials, and minimizes the carbon footprint compared to demolition and new builds.
- Cost Efficiency – While some projects require extensive renovations, adaptive reuse can often be less expensive than starting from scratch.
- Historic Preservation – Repurposing older buildings maintains architectural heritage, which can enhance neighborhood character and tourism appeal.
- Urban Revitalization – Bringing unused buildings back to life can energize entire districts, attracting new residents, businesses, and visitors.
Key Considerations in Adaptive Reuse Projects
Dr. Robertson emphasizes that successful adaptive reuse projects require careful planning:
- Structural Integrity – Engineers must ensure the building can safely handle its new use.
- Zoning and Building Codes – Local regulations may limit certain conversions or require upgrades to meet modern standards.
- Environmental Remediation – Older buildings may contain asbestos, lead paint, or other hazardous materials that must be safely removed.
- Design Integration – Balancing the preservation of original architectural elements with the functionality of modern design is both an art and a science.

Challenges in Implementation
Despite its benefits, adaptive reuse isn’t without hurdles:
- Unpredictable Costs – Renovation work can uncover hidden structural issues.
- Financing – Some lenders are wary of unconventional projects without comparable sales data.
- Regulatory Delays – Navigating preservation requirements and special permits can extend timelines.
Dr. Robertson notes that overcoming these challenges often requires collaboration among developers, architects, city planners, and community stakeholders.
Case Studies of Adaptive Reuse Success
Around the world, adaptive reuse has breathed new life into iconic structures. In New York City, the High Line transformed an elevated freight rail line into a public park, spurring billions in new development nearby.
In Los Angeles, old warehouses in the Arts District have been converted into lofts, galleries, and restaurants, creating one of the city’s most vibrant neighborhoods.
